She's Spanish at heart, and boy can she sing!,
By Sound of Musik (New York) - See all my reviews
This review is from: Flor Nocturna (Audio CD)
Marta is from the Czech Republic, by way of Seattle, and has called NYC home for about a decade. She writes and sings in Spanish, with spare acoustic instrumentation that includes cello, flute, viola, marimba, the wonderful Jenny Scheinman on violin - and beautifully accompanies herself on quatro, the small, four string Spanish guitar. Her songs are elegant, spellbinding affairs of longing and romance. Although sung in Spanish, the liner notes offer translations in English. I saw her perform recently at a rare small club solo gig in lower Manhattan, and she conveys a deep passion and resonance with her material. Her voice and persona are truly beautiful.

Awesome natural sound of an exceptional artist,
This review is from: Flor Nocturna (Audio CD)
This is sun, sea, wilderness and poetry in music. Marta is all exception, she is all new generation in diversity yet purity, from east european background she sings and plays latin rooted songs like a trubadour with a depth solely praised to native artists. Her counter alto voice is earthy ethereal clear and deep. Not only her voice is a gift but she masters El Cuatro a latin guitar. I'd give a five star note to her previous album "La Marea" which is less reflective/meditative it has some great uptempo tunes "Flor Nocturna" misses.
